The Intel Core i7-13705H features 14 processor cores and has the capability to manage 20 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q1/2023 and belongs to the 13 generation of the Intel Core i7 series.
To use the Intel Core i7-13705H, you'll need a motherboard with a BGA 1744 socket.
The Intel Xeon Gold 6242R features 20 processor cores and has the capability to manage 40 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q1/2020 and belongs to the 2 generation of the Intel Xeon Gold series.
To use the Intel Xeon Gold 6242R, you'll need a motherboard with a LGA 3647 socket.

The Intel Core i7-13705H has integrated graphics, called iGPU for short.
Specifically, the Intel Core i7-13705H uses the Intel Iris Xe Graphics 96 (Alder Lake), which has 768 texture shaders
and 96 execution units.
The iGPU uses the system's main memory as graphics memory and sits on the processor's die.
The Intel Xeon Gold 6242R does not have integrated graphics.
